A Watford FC podcast from the Watford Observer, presented by Ryan Gray.

Episode 8 - Season preview Ft. Oscar O'Mara and Xisco Munoz

August 13, 2021 11:08 - 24 minutes - 22 MB

Oscar O'Mara from Vavel joins Ryan to discuss the Aston Villa game this weekend, the on-going Will Hughes situation and their hopes for both the team and Xisco Munoz this season. We also hear from Xisco himself, as he reveals how he is feeling ahead of the new campaign, and what he expects from his players. Hosted on Acast. See acast.com/privacy for more information.

Episode 7 - Fabrizio Romano

July 29, 2021 23:00 - 13 minutes - 11.9 MB

In this week's episode of the Wobcast we speak to football fan, transfer specialist and Watford supporter Fabrizio Romano about how he fell in love with the Hornets and why he can't wait to get back to Vicarage Road. We also discuss a couple of transfer targets, the midfield problem and why Xisco Munoz could be the right man for the job this season. Hosted on Acast. See acast.com/privacy for more information.

Episode 6 - Jacob & Sam WD18

July 22, 2021 23:00 - 37 minutes - 34.4 MB

This week we chat to Jacob Culshaw and Sam Ucko from WD18 about Watford's transfer business so far this season and what ought to be done about players like Will Hughes and Nathaniel Chalobah who are both yet to sign new contracts. We also try and predict the first starting XI of the season, with the first match of the season drawing a bit closer. Episode 5 - WOW (Women of Watford)

July 16, 2021 08:20 - 22 minutes - 20.5 MB

Episode 5 of the Wobcast includes a chat with three of the Women of Watford founding members, as they prepare for their first season as a supporter's group. Hear about how the group was started, what their aims are and how you can get involved if you'd like. Visit www.watfordobserver.co.uk for any other Watford-related news. Hosted on Acast. Episode 4 - Adekite Fatuga-Dada

June 29, 2021 23:00 - 13 minutes - 12.7 MB

In this episode we speak to Watford FC women's longest-serving player Adekite Fatuga-Dada about her time with the club, the development of the women's game and the Golden Girls' promotion to the FA Women's Championship. Hosted on Acast. See acast.com/privacy for more information.

Episode 3 - Kelme

June 22, 2021 23:00 - 12 minutes - 11.8 MB

In this episode we talk to Rob Lowe, UK Brand Manager from Watford's kit manufacturer Kelme. We discuss kit design, the thorny issue of the colour red, and the brand's relationship with the Hornets. Hosted on Acast. See acast.com/privacy for more information.

Episode 2 - Mike Parkin

June 16, 2021 15:57 - 14 minutes - 13.2 MB

In this episode we speak to special guest Mike Parkin from the From the Rookery End podcast about the 2021/22 fixture list, which fixtures he's looking forward to, which ones he isn't and where Watford can pick up points next season as they look to cement their place in the Premier League. Episode 1 - Chris Stark

June 11, 2021 04:36 - 31 minutes - 43.9 MB

In this episode we talk to BBC Radio One and That Peter Crouch Podcast presenter Chris Stark about Watford's last season in the Championship, the impact of Xisco Munoz and how we think the Hornets will do back in the Premier League. Hosted on Acast. See acast.com/privacy for more information.
